新野县12345_后端

T_CTI_TaskCategory.cs 2.2K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869
  1. using System;
  2. using System.Collections.Generic;
  3. using System.Data;
  4. using System.Linq;
  5. using System.Text;
  6. using System.Threading.Tasks;
  7. namespace CallCenterApi.BLL
  8. {
  9. public class T_CTI_TaskCategory
  10. {
  11. private readonly DAL.T_CTI_TaskCategory dal = new DAL.T_CTI_TaskCategory();
  12. /// <summary>
  13. /// 增加一条数据
  14. /// </summary>
  15. public long Add(Model.T_CTI_TaskCategory model)
  16. {
  17. return dal.Add(model);
  18. }
  19. /// <summary>
  20. /// 更新一条数据
  21. /// </summary>
  22. public bool Update(CallCenterApi.Model.T_CTI_TaskCategory model)
  23. {
  24. return dal.Update(model);
  25. }
  26. /// <summary>
  27. /// 删除一条数据
  28. /// </summary>
  29. public bool Delete(int id)
  30. {
  31. return dal.Delete(id);
  32. }
  33. /// <summary>
  34. /// 得到一个对象实体
  35. /// </summary>
  36. public CallCenterApi.Model.T_CTI_TaskCategory GetModel(int id)
  37. {
  38. return dal.GetModel(id);
  39. }
  40. /// <summary>
  41. /// 获得数据列表
  42. /// </summary>
  43. public List<CallCenterApi.Model.T_CTI_TaskCategory> DataTableToList(DataTable dt)
  44. {
  45. List<CallCenterApi.Model.T_CTI_TaskCategory> modelList = new List<CallCenterApi.Model.T_CTI_TaskCategory>();
  46. int rowsCount = dt.Rows.Count;
  47. if (rowsCount > 0)
  48. {
  49. CallCenterApi.Model.T_CTI_TaskCategory model;
  50. for (int n = 0; n < rowsCount; n++)
  51. {
  52. model = new CallCenterApi.Model.T_CTI_TaskCategory();
  53. model.F_Id = Convert.ToInt32(dt.Rows[n]["F_Id"]);
  54. model.F_ParentId = Convert.ToInt32(dt.Rows[n]["F_ParentId"]);
  55. model.F_Name = dt.Rows[n]["F_Name"] == DBNull.Value ? "" : dt.Rows[n]["F_Name"].ToString();
  56. model.F_ParentName = dt.Rows[n]["F_ParentName"] == DBNull.Value ? "" : dt.Rows[n]["F_ParentName"].ToString();
  57. modelList.Add(model);
  58. }
  59. }
  60. return modelList;
  61. }
  62. public DataSet GetList(string where)
  63. {
  64. return dal.GetList(where);
  65. }
  66. }
  67. }